INSPECTION PROCEDURE

HINT:



If troubleshooting (wire harness inspection) is difficult to perform, remove the passenger seat installa-
tion bolts to see the under surface of seat cushion.



In the above case, hold the seat so that it does not fall down. Holding the seat for a long period of time
may cause a problem, such as seat rail deformation. Hold the seat only as necessary.

1

Check DTC.

CHECK:
(a)

Turn the ignition switch to the ON position.

(b)

Clear the DTCs stored in memory (see page 

DI–1147

).

HINT:
First clear DTCs stored in the occupant classification ECU and then in the airbag sensor assembly.
(c)

Turn the ignition switch to the LOCK position.

(d)

Turn the ignition switch to the ON position.

(e)

Using the hand–held tester, check the DTCs of the occupant classification ECU (see page 

DI–1147

).

OK:

DTC B1783 is not output.

HINT:
Codes other than DTC B1783 may be output at this time, but they are not related to this check.

NG

Go to step 2.

OK

From the results of the above inspection, the malfunctioning part can now be considered normal.
To make sure of this, use the simulation method to check (see page 

DI–1137

).

2

Check connection of connectors.

PREPARATION:
(a)

Turn the ignition switch to the LOCK position.

(b)

Disconnect the negative (–) terminal cable from the battery, and wait for at least 90 seconds.

CHECK:
Check that the connectors are properly connected to the occupant classification ECU and the occupant clas-
sification sensor rear RH.
OK:

The connectors are connected securely.

NG

Connect connectors, then go to step 1.

OK

3

Check seat wire No. 1 (short to B+).

PREPARATION:
(a)

Disconnect the connectors from the occupant classifica-
tion ECU and the occupant classification sensor rear RH.

(b)

Connect the negative (–) terminal cable to the battery.

CHECK:
(a)

Turn the ignition switch to the ON position.

(b)

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table
below.

OK:

Tester Connection

Condition

Specified Condition

O7–4 (SGD4) – 

Body ground

Ignition switch ON

Below 1 V

O7–6 (SVC4) – 

Body ground

Ignition switch ON

Below 1 V

O7–10 (SIG4) – 

Body ground

Ignition switch ON

Below 1 V

NG

Repair or replace seat wire No. 1.

OK

4

Check seat wire No. 1 (open).

PREPARATION:
(a)

Turn the ignition switch to the LOCK position.

(b)

Disconnect the negative (–) terminal cable from the bat-
tery, and wait for at least 90 seconds.

(c)

Using a service wire, connect O11–1 (SVC4) and O11–3
(SGD4), O11–2 (SIG4) and O11–3 (SGD4) of connector
”C”.

NOTICE:
Do not forcibly insert a service wire into the terminals of the
connector when connecting.
CHECK:
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table
below.
OK:

Tester Connection

Condition

Specified Condition

O7–6 (SVC4) – 

O7–4 (SGD4)

Always

Below 1 

O7–10 (SIG4) – 

O7–4 (SGD4)

Always

Below 1 

NG

Repair or replace seat wire No. 1.

OK
